Key Components of an Effective Estate Plan

Creating an effective estate plan involves several critical components. Each element plays a vital role in ensuring that your estate is managed according to your wishes:

  • Wills and Trusts: These foundational documents outline how your assets should be distributed. Trusts can offer additional benefits, such as reducing tax burdens and providing for minor children.
  • Power of Attorney: This legal document allows you to appoint someone to make decisions on your behalf if you become incapacitated. In the GTA, where life can be unpredictable, having a trusted individual manage your affairs is invaluable.
  • Healthcare Directives: Also known as living wills, these directives specify your healthcare preferences should you be unable to communicate them yourself.
  • Beneficiary Designations: Ensure that your life insurance policies, retirement accounts, and other assets have up-to-date beneficiary designations to align with your estate planning goals.

Asset Management and Protection

In the Greater Toronto Area, effective asset management is a cornerstone of estate planning. Given the region's dynamic real estate market and investment opportunities, it's crucial to develop strategies that protect your wealth while maximizing growth potential. This involves:

  • Diversifying Investments: Spreading your investments across various asset classes can mitigate risks and enhance returns.
  • Real Estate Planning: With property values in the GTA consistently on the rise, real estate can be a significant part of your estate. Proper planning ensures that your properties are transferred efficiently and cost-effectively.
  • Tax Planning: Estate planning in Canada requires a keen understanding of tax implications. Strategies such as gifting, charitable donations, and establishing trusts can minimize tax liabilities.

Addressing Family Dynamics in Estate Planning

In the Greater Toronto Area, family structures can be diverse and multifaceted, making estate planning a delicate process. Whether dealing with blended families, second marriages, or international relatives, it's crucial to approach your estate plan with sensitivity and foresight. Open communication with family members can help mitigate potential conflicts and ensure everyone understands your intentions. Consideration of each family member's unique needs and circumstances is key to creating a harmonious plan that honors your wishes and supports your loved ones.

Leveraging Estate Planning for Business Owners in the GTA

For business owners and entrepreneurs in the Greater Toronto Area, estate planning is not only about personal assets but also about the future of your business. Ensuring a smooth transition of leadership and ownership is crucial for maintaining the continuity and success of your enterprise. This involves creating a succession plan that outlines who will take over the business and how it will be managed in your absence. Collaborating with financial advisors and legal experts can help you develop a plan that aligns with your business goals and family interests.

Integrating Tax Strategies into Your Estate Plan

Tax efficiency is a critical aspect of estate planning, especially in a region like the GTA where tax laws can be intricate. By incorporating strategic tax planning into your estate plan, you can minimize the tax burden on your estate and maximize the inheritance for your beneficiaries. Techniques such as establishing family trusts, utilizing tax-free savings accounts, and making strategic charitable donations can provide significant tax relief. Engaging with tax professionals can ensure that you are taking full advantage of available tax benefits and structuring your estate plan to optimize financial outcomes.
